Manulife (Manufacturers Life Insurance)’s Beacon Roofing Supply, Inc. BECN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
Sell
-24,902
Closed -$3.08M 3023
2025
Q1
$3.08M Sell
24,902
-8,522
-25% -$1.05M ﹤0.01% 1338
2024
Q4
$3.4M Sell
33,424
-10,639
-24% -$1.08M ﹤0.01% 1351
2024
Q3
$3.81M Sell
44,063
-848
-2% -$73.3K ﹤0.01% 1328
2024
Q2
$4.06M Buy
44,911
+8,924
+25% +$808K ﹤0.01% 1249
2024
Q1
$3.53M Buy
35,987
+5,156
+17% +$505K ﹤0.01% 1322
2023
Q4
$2.68M Buy
30,831
+3,965
+15% +$345K ﹤0.01% 1375
2023
Q3
$2.07M Buy
26,866
+6,810
+34% +$526K ﹤0.01% 1425
2023
Q2
$1.66M Sell
20,056
-908
-4% -$75.3K ﹤0.01% 1464
2023
Q1
$1.23M Buy
20,964
+150
+0.7% +$8.83K ﹤0.01% 1534
2022
Q4
$1.1M Sell
20,814
-1,033
-5% -$54.5K ﹤0.01% 1566
2022
Q3
$1.2M Sell
21,847
-408
-2% -$22.3K ﹤0.01% 1536
2022
Q2
$1.14M Sell
22,255
-1,147
-5% -$58.9K ﹤0.01% 1595
2022
Q1
$1.39M Sell
23,402
-5,244
-18% -$311K ﹤0.01% 1613
2021
Q4
$1.64K Sell
28,646
-372
-1% -$21 ﹤0.01% 1577
2021
Q3
$1.39M Sell
29,018
-2,704
-9% -$129K ﹤0.01% 1648
2021
Q2
$1.69M Buy
31,722
+825
+3% +$43.9K ﹤0.01% 1684
2021
Q1
$1.62M Sell
30,897
-2,157
-7% -$113K ﹤0.01% 1638
2020
Q4
$1.33M Buy
33,054
+1,223
+4% +$49.1K ﹤0.01% 1685
2020
Q3
$989K Sell
31,831
-1,083
-3% -$33.6K ﹤0.01% 1666
2020
Q2
$857K Sell
32,914
-6,091
-16% -$159K ﹤0.01% 1693
2020
Q1
$645K Sell
39,005
-1,705
-4% -$28.2K ﹤0.01% 1715
2019
Q4
$1.3M Sell
40,710
-1,077
-3% -$34.4K ﹤0.01% 1559
2019
Q3
$1.4M Sell
41,787
-168
-0.4% -$5.61K ﹤0.01% 1495
2019
Q2
$1.54M Sell
41,955
-2,562
-6% -$94.1K ﹤0.01% 1456
2019
Q1
$1.43M Buy
44,517
+2,806
+7% +$90.3K ﹤0.01% 1529
2018
Q4
$1.32M Sell
41,711
-2,323
-5% -$73.7K ﹤0.01% 1480
2018
Q3
$1.59M Sell
44,034
-6,176
-12% -$223K ﹤0.01% 1545
2018
Q2
$2.14M Sell
50,210
-42
-0.1% -$1.79K ﹤0.01% 1474
2018
Q1
$2.67M Sell
50,252
-130
-0.3% -$6.9K ﹤0.01% 1400
2017
Q4
$3.21M Buy
50,382
+2,784
+6% +$177K ﹤0.01% 1343
2017
Q3
$2.44M Buy
47,598
+1,171
+3% +$60K ﹤0.01% 1372
2017
Q2
$2.28M Buy
46,427
+517
+1% +$25.3K ﹤0.01% 1409
2017
Q1
$2.26M Buy
45,910
+5,598
+14% +$275K ﹤0.01% 1388
2016
Q4
$1.86M Buy
40,312
+68
+0.2% +$3.13K ﹤0.01% 1402
2016
Q3
$1.69M Buy
40,244
+182
+0.5% +$7.66K ﹤0.01% 1424
2016
Q2
$1.82M Buy
40,062
+7,125
+22% +$324K ﹤0.01% 1382
2016
Q1
$1.36M Sell
32,937
-416
-1% -$17.2K ﹤0.01% 1485
2015
Q4
$1.37K Sell
33,353
-79,021
-70% -$3.26K ﹤0.01% 1491
2015
Q3
$3.65K Sell
112,374
-37,567
-25% -$1.22K ﹤0.01% 1171
2015
Q2
$4.98K Buy
149,941
+18,506
+14% +$615 0.01% 1050
2015
Q1
$4.11K Sell
131,435
-42,752
-25% -$1.34K 0.01% 1130
2014
Q4
$4.84K Buy
174,187
+4,694
+3% +$130 0.01% 999
2014
Q3
$4.32K Buy
169,493
+1,054
+0.6% +$27 0.01% 1058
2014
Q2
$5.58M Sell
168,439
-11,299
-6% -$374K 0.01% 950
2014
Q1
$6.95K Sell
179,738
-306,284
-63% -$11.8K 0.01% 846
2013
Q4
$19.6K Buy
486,022
+74,955
+18% +$3.02K 0.03% 421
2013
Q3
$15.2K Buy
411,067
+208,720
+103% +$7.7K 0.03% 493
2013
Q2
$7.67M Buy
+202,347
New +$7.67M 0.01% 666